In the U.S., there ae about 5.2 million Jews, 15 % of which keep strict kosher. What is becoming more popular though is the eco-kosher diet. According to Grist,

Its followers seek nourishment that not only adheres to traditional Jewish dietary laws, but is also local, organic, sustainable, and humane.

A label will soon be generated to make it easier for those looking to support processors with these ethical values. This segment of the diet will include roughly 100,000 items which may have substantial positive effects on the environment.
